linux如何配置mysql数据库服务器

worktile 其他 34

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要配置MySQL数据库服务器,您可以按照以下步骤进行操作:

    步骤1:安装MySQL服务器
    首先,确保您的Linux系统上已安装了MySQL服务器。可以使用包管理器来安装MySQL,例如在Ubuntu上使用apt,或者在CentOS上使用yum。执行以下命令安装MySQL服务器:

    在Ubuntu上:
    sudo apt-get install mysql-server

    在CentOS上:
    sudo yum install mysql-server

    步骤2:启动MySQL服务器
    安装完成后,使用以下命令启动MySQL服务器:

    在Ubuntu上:
    sudo service mysql start

    在CentOS上:
    sudo systemctl start mysqld

    步骤3:配置MySQL服务器
    一旦MySQL服务器已启动,您需要进行一些配置以确保其安全性和功能性。首先,运行以下命令以设置root用户的密码:

    sudo mysql_secure_installation

    按照提示进行操作,设置root密码,并删除匿名用户、禁用远程root登录等。

    步骤4:访问MySQL服务器
    使用以下命令访问MySQL服务器:

    sudo mysql -u root -p

    您会被要求输入之前设置的root密码。登录成功后,您将进入MySQL服务器的命令行界面。

    步骤5:创建和管理数据库
    您可以使用MySQL命令行或图形化工具,如phpMyAdmin来创建和管理数据库。在MySQL命令行中,执行以下命令来创建一个新的数据库:

    CREATE DATABASE database_name;

    您可以使用以下命令列出所有数据库:

    SHOW DATABASES;

    步骤6:创建用户并授予权限
    为了安全起见,您可以创建一个新用户,并为其分配对特定数据库的权限。以下是使用MySQL命令行创建用户并授予权限的示例:

    C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';
    G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'localhost';
    FLUSH PRIVILEGES;

    请将"username"和"password"替换为您想要设置的实际用户名和密码,"database_name"替换为您要授权的数据库名称。

    步骤7:配置和优化MySQL服务器
    根据您的需求,您可以进一步配置和优化MySQL服务器。您可以编辑MySQL配置文件(通常在/etc/mysql/mysql.conf.d/mysqld.cnf或/etc/my.cnf)来更改服务器的设置,如最大连接数、缓冲区大小等。

    最后,您需要重启MySQL服务器以使设置生效:

    在Ubuntu上:
    sudo service mysql restart

    在CentOS上:
    sudo systemctl restart mysqld

    完成以上步骤后,您的MySQL数据库服务器将成功配置并准备好使用。您可以开始创建表、插入数据并执行其他操作了。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要配置MySQL数据库服务器,您需要按照以下步骤进行操作:

    1. 安装MySQL:首先,您需要安装MySQL服务器软件。可以使用以下命令在Linux系统上安装MySQL:

      sudo apt-get update
      sudo apt-get install mysql-server
      
    2. 配置MySQL:安装完成后,可以通过编辑配置文件来进行进一步的MySQL配置。MySQL的主要配置文件位于 /etc/mysql/mysql.conf.d/mysqld.cnf (Debian/Ubuntu)或者 /etc/my.cnf (CentOS/RHEL)。您可以根据需求进行调整,例如更改端口号、设置字符集等。

    3. 启动MySQL:安装和配置完成后,通过以下命令启动MySQL服务:

      sudo systemctl start mysql
      

      关闭MySQL服务的命令如下:

      sudo systemctl stop mysql
      
    4. 登录MySQL:一旦MySQL服务器正在运行,您可以使用以下命令登录到MySQL命令行界面:

      mysql -u 用户名 -p
      

      在提示符出现时,您需要输入MySQL用户的密码。

    5. 创建数据库和用户:在MySQL命令行界面中,您可以使用以下命令创建数据库和用户:

      CREATE DATABASE 数据库名;
      
      CREATE USER '用户名'@'localhost' IDENTIFIED BY '密码';
      

      将数据库名、用户名和密码替换为您自己的值。然后,您可以为新创建的用户授予适当的权限:

      GRANT ALL PRIVILEGES ON 数据库名.* TO '用户名'@'localhost';
      

      最后,使用以下命令刷新权限更改:

      FLUSH PRIVILEGES;
      

      此后,新用户将能够使用密码登录并操作指定的数据库。

    以上是在Linux系统上配置MySQL数据库服务器的基本步骤。根据需要,您还可以进行其他高级配置,如设置远程访问、备份和恢复数据等。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Linux配置MySQL数据库服务器的步骤如下:

    1. 安装MySQL数据库

    在Linux系统上安装MySQL数据库服务器可以使用包管理器,例如在Debian/Ubuntu系统上使用apt命令:

    sudo apt-get install mysql-server
    

    在CentOS/RHEL系统上使用yum命令:

    sudo yum install mysql-server
    

    在安装过程中,会提示输入数据库管理员的密码,输入并记住该密码。

    1. 启动并设置MySQL服务

    安装完成后,使用以下命令启动MySQL服务:

    sudo systemctl start mysql
    

    为了让MySQL服务器在系统启动时自动启动,可以使用以下命令启用MySQL服务:

    sudo systemctl enable mysql
    
    1. 对MySQL进行安全设置

    MySQL安装完成后,可以使用以下命令来进行基本的安全设置:

    sudo mysql_secure_installation
    

    该命令会提示一系列安全设置选项,包括移除匿名用户、禁止远程登录等。根据需要选择合适的选项并按照提示进行操作。

    1. 连接MySQL数据库服务器

    使用以下命令连接MySQL数据库服务器:

    mysql -u root -p
    

    然后输入之前设置的数据库管理员密码。

    1. 创建和管理数据库

    成功连接MySQL服务器后,可以使用以下命令来创建和管理数据库:

    创建数据库:

    CREATE DATABASE database_name;
    

    列出所有数据库:

    SHOW DATABASES;
    

    选择数据库:

    USE database_name;
    
    1. 创建和管理数据库用户

    为了增加安全性,可以为数据库创建用户,并限制这些用户对数据库的访问权限。

    创建用户:

    C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';
    

    授权用户访问数据库:

    GRANT ALL PRIVILEGES ON database_name.* TO 'username'@'localhost';
    

    刷新权限:

    FLUSH PRIVILEGES;
    
    1. 配置MySQL服务器

    MySQL服务器的配置文件一般位于/etc/mysql/mysql.conf.d目录下,可以使用任何文本编辑器来编辑该文件进行配置。

    例如,如果需要更改MySQL服务器的监听地址,可以编辑文件/etc/mysql/mysql.conf.d/mysqld.cnf,并将bind-address的值更改为所需的IP地址,然后保存文件并重启MySQL服务器。

    sudo systemctl restart mysql
    

    以上就是在Linux上配置MySQL数据库服务器的步骤。请根据具体需求进行自定义配置。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部